Homeschooling a four-year-old in the US often looks very different from traditional, structured academic environments. Instead of sitting at a desk for six hours, the gold standard for this age group is play-based learning. This approach allows children to spend most of their time simply being kids while naturally developing essential skills. Parents have the freedom to move away from strict curricula and adapt to their child's specific needs and pace.
Yes, play-based learning is highly effective for early childhood education as it helps children build a foundation for math, literacy, and social skills. Through activities like building blocks and pretend play, children are actively learning rather than falling behind. This method busts the myth that rigorous academics are necessary at age four, proving that playing is the primary way young children absorb new concepts and prepare for future schooling.
Indian parents used to a rigorous and structured academic environment may feel pressure when starting homeschooling in the US. However, it is important to understand that the US system at this age prizes play over formal desk work. By embracing play-based learning, parents can relieve the stress of feeling caught between two worlds. Homeschooling provides the total freedom to move away from a chalkboard setup and focus on what truly benefits a four-year-old.
